Developed by the National Mental Health Commission, this guide provides a comprehensive and action-oriented framework for meaningful engagement of mental-health consumers and carers within policy, service and organisational settings. 

The document offers four progressive steps:

⦁ Identify ways to engage – including a spectrum of engagement from consultation to citizen-led co-production. 
⦁ Consider best-practice principles – such as embedding engagement as routine practice, recognising the expertise of lived-experience, resourcing activities, leadership culture, respect, safety and evaluation.
